Frequently Asked Questions

What are the main canyons to explore around Bovec?

The Bovec region is renowned for its diverse canyons, primarily shaped by the Soča River. Key areas include the Large Soča rock pools, where the river has carved impressive troughs, and the Great Soča Gorge (Velika korita Soče), a natural monument featuring a 750-meter-long channel. Other notable canyons for exploration and canyoning include Sušec, Fratarica, and Predelnica.

Are there canyons suitable for beginners or families in Bovec?

Yes, several canyons cater to beginners and families. Srnica Adventure Park is family-friendly, offering trails and activities. For canyoning, Sušec Canyon is ideal for beginners and families with children aged 10 and up, known for its natural water slides and optional jumps. The Soča Gorge Swimming Area also provides a gentle introduction to the river with areas for sunbathing and swimming.

Which canyons offer a more challenging experience for experienced adventurers?

For those seeking a greater challenge, Fratarica Canyon is an excellent intermediate option, featuring spectacular waterfalls like the 47-meter 'Parabola' and requiring rappelling. Predelnica Canyon is the most demanding, recommended for experienced adventurers due to its steep drops, technical descents, and numerous waterfalls, with the highest rappel reaching 45 meters. It offers a wild, remote experience that can take up to 7 hours to complete.

What natural features can I expect to see in the canyons around Bovec?

The canyons around Bovec showcase stunning natural beauty within Triglav National Park. You'll encounter emerald-green and blue pools, dramatic waterfalls, narrow gorges carved into limestone, and unique rock formations. Highlights like the Large Soča rock pools and the Great Soča Gorge exemplify the river's powerful erosive force. Lush vegetation and impressive cliffs also contribute to the picturesque landscape of the Julian Alps.

What is the best time of year to visit the canyons in Bovec?

The best time to visit the canyons for activities like canyoning and swimming is typically during the warmer months, from late spring through early autumn. This period offers more favorable weather conditions and water temperatures for enjoying the aquatic features of the canyons. Always check local weather forecasts before your visit.

Are there opportunities for swimming in the canyons?

Yes, there are several spots for swimming. The Soča Gorge Swimming Area is a popular choice with a beach and cool water. The Large Soča rock pools also offer opportunities for swimming in clear water. For canyoning, both Fratarica and Predelnica canyons feature crystal-clear emerald pools where you can swim after slides and jumps.

Are there any viewpoints to admire the canyons from above?

Absolutely. You can get spectacular views from various points, such as the View of the Soča River from the Bridge and the Suspension Bridge over the Soča Gorge. These bridges offer panoramic perspectives of the river carving its way through the landscape. The Large Soča rock pools are also beautiful to see from the suspension bridge and the edge of the gorge.

What other outdoor activities can I do near the canyons in Bovec?

Beyond canyon exploration, Bovec offers a wide range of outdoor activities. You can find numerous hiking trails, including the scenic Soča Trail (Soška Pot). The region is also excellent for mountain biking and gravel biking, with routes like the Soča Gorge – Vršič Pass loop. The Srnica Adventure Park provides climbing and other family-friendly activities.

Are there any specific permits required for canyoning in Bovec?

Yes, canyoning in the Bovec region, especially within Triglav National Park, often requires specific permits or adherence to regulations. It is highly recommended to go with a licensed guide, particularly for technical canyons like Fratarica and Predelnica, as they will handle the necessary permits and ensure safety. Always check with local authorities or tour operators for the most current requirements.

How long does a typical canyoning trip take in Bovec?

The duration of a canyoning trip in Bovec varies significantly depending on the canyon and your experience level. Beginner-friendly canyons like Sušec typically take a few hours, including the approach and descent. Intermediate canyons like Fratarica might take longer, around 3-5 hours. The most challenging canyon, Predelnica, can be a full-day adventure, taking up to 7 hours to complete due to its length and technical nature.

Where can I find parking near the canyoning spots?

Parking availability varies by canyon. For instance, near the Soča Gorge Swimming Area, there is a designated parking space, though it typically costs a small fee per hour. For guided canyoning trips, tour operators often provide transport to the canyon entry points or advise on specific meeting and parking locations. It's always best to confirm parking arrangements with your guide or check local signage.

Are there any historical sites near the canyons?

Yes, the region around Bovec has historical significance. The Koritnica Valley, which features a gorge, is also recognized as a historical site. The broader Soča Valley played a significant role during World War I, and remnants of this history can be found throughout the area, often alongside the natural beauty of the canyons.
